Security Steps After Account Setup
After the account is in hand, make the practical habits a part of the account:
- Use a complex and distinctive password.
- Evaluate and refresh recovery plans
- Allow the use of security features that are available.
- Monitor active sessions and devices connected
- Don't share information about recovery.
- Do not open suspicious emails and attachments
- Only provide credentials when absolutely needed
- Be alert to any unusual activity in your accounts.
These measures will help to secure the email and minimize risks on a daily basis.
